This one has been on the bench (or a facsimile thereof) for the past 10-11 years.  The original vision was for a streetable car that would lurk the streets looking for a certain flat black 55 Chevy.  However the cheater slicks were destined for another build, so I went full Gasser on this one.



The intake manifold and headers are scratchbuilt.  Unfortunately, I got sloppy on final assembly and the cool can interferes with the hood closing.



The SCRambler is a unibody car, so with all the torque of the BBC I decided a set of subframe connectors would be in order, as well as some ladder bars.  A I said the original idea was for a streetable car, that is why it has a full exhaust system.



Final picture of the engine in all its naked glory.  The HEI ignition was bought from a closing Hobby Shop more that 15 years ago.  It is a beautiful pewter casting and I have been unable to find any more.
